It is estimated there are over 6.7 billion people on this planet. That's a huge number, and the problems that confront us are equally huge. Sometimes it just seems pointless to try to make a difference. But you don't have to be Mother Teresa, Martin Luther King or Ahn Sahng Soo Chi to accomplish small, and huge, things. First meet Jenenne Whitfield. She was minding her own business, successfully climbing the corporate ladder when she made an unexpected turn...and now she's putting her business smarts to work for the arts...and trying to bring a dying city back to life. Too often we believe that you have to be some kind of expert, someone special to accomplish something amazing. This story is for you...Tricia Haggerty Wenz has accomplished something that combines urban renewal, affordable housing and social activism in Newburgh, New York. SafeHarbor is still growing...it's restoring a nearby abandoned theatre, is partnering with a performance venue and a local coffee shop...and some of the people who work there will be tenants of the Newburgh Hotel. You can find out more at www.safeharborsofthehudson.org

Not too far from Newburgh is a food pantry with a can-do attitude. Diane Reeder runs The Queens Galley in Kingston, NY...they serve three meals a day, seven days a week restaurant style...and despite constant money worries, they're serving thousands of people a month.
